AI Summary
- Recognizes and commends Iron Workers Local 387 on its 100th anniversary, having been chartered by the International Association of Bridge, Structural, and Ornamental Iron Workers on January 30, 1924
- Iron Workers Local 387 represents skilled tradespeople from more than 114 counties in Georgia
- The organization provides free training to youth who may not pursue college pathways and engages in social programs to empower disadvantaged and dislocated workers
- Through collective bargaining, the local has standardized wages and benefits for its workforce
- Directs the Clerk of the House of Representatives to provide a copy of the resolution to Iron Workers Local 387
